コード例 #1
0
ファイル: GoodsBlockWarp.cs プロジェクト: zanderphh/Shop
 private void Handle(GoodsBlockWarpDeletedEvent evnt)
 {
     _info = null;
 }
コード例 #2
0
ファイル: GoodsBlockWarp.cs プロジェクト: zanderphh/Shop
 /// <summary>
 /// 更新
 /// </summary>
 /// <param name="info"></param>
 public void Update(GoodsBlockWarpInfo info)
 {
     info.CheckNotNull(nameof(info));
     ApplyEvent(new GoodsBlockWarpUpdatedEvent(info));
 }
コード例 #3
0
ファイル: GoodsBlockWarp.cs プロジェクト: zanderphh/Shop
 private void Handle(GoodsBlockWarpUpdatedEvent evnt)
 {
     _info = evnt.Info;
 }
コード例 #4
0
ファイル: GoodsBlockWarp.cs プロジェクト: zanderphh/Shop
 public GoodsBlockWarp(Guid id, GoodsBlockWarpInfo info) : base(id)
 {
     info.CheckNotNull(nameof(info));
     ApplyEvent(new GoodsBlockWarpCreatedEvent(info));
 }